Get some Adrenalin Rush with Aruba Kitesurfing and Windsurfing
Exploring the waters of the great Aruban Island is a good way to discover different kinds of waters sports from the timid like swimming or jet skiing to the more extreme sports. The wind combined with its calm waters is also a good combination for such extreme sports as kitesurfing and windsurfing with two companies experts on teaching them, Red Sail Sports Aruba and Aruba Kite Surfing School. Aruba Kite Surfing has many packages to offer beginners and is considered a member of the National Surf Association. A beginner package will get tourists about 5 hours of lessons for $275 and $200 for private lessons. The other company, Red Sail Sports Aruba, has been teaching windsurfing for quite sometime and has a great fleet to assist with the task for beginners. The staff offers classes for beginners, letting them feel the waters, and ultimately appreciate the great Aruban landscape, seascape and air.
Arubas Old Gold Mills
Originally, before becoming a tourist destination, Aruba was famous for being a gold town with adventurers and settlers in the 1500s calling it the land rich with Oro Ruba or red gold. Thus, there were many attempts to capture this Caribbean island in search of the natural treasure. Now called Aruba, the islands origins can still be seen through the gold mill ruins that still make money by being a popular destination for tourists and adventurers. The first gold mill is the Bushiribana Gold Mill which is found at the Northern part of Aruba where once, 3 million pounds of gold was churned out from 1824 until the supply depleted but still as is, Bushiribana is a great place to be in especially since its found beside the Aruban beachfront. Theres also the Balashi Gold Mill which is found on the islands Spanish Lagoon. Balashi was part of the gold mining industry and traces of their popularity are clearly seen with the remaining gold smelters in this historic structure.
Tourist Horseback Riding in Aruba
From its Spanish Roots, Aruba developed a fondness for horses that is still inculcated in their local culture today with many Arubans subconsciously developing a fondness for these four-legged creatures, becoming enthusiasts or professional riders. Sharing their love for these four-legged creatures, Luis and Ramon Herrera decided to make the Rancho la Ponderosa, dedicated to provide tourists and locals the experience of riding a horse through different Aruban terrain. They have over thirty years of experience, bringing visitors to the beachfront in Wairiruri Beach down to the old Gold Mill ruins. Another tour also takes visitors to the Ostrich Farm, the Bushiribana Ruins and the Natural Bridge, one of Arubas most preserved and historic attractions. This will cost about $100 for adults and $65 for kids but is a worthy experience to take if only for its authenticity and a taste of the old lifestyle during your Aruban vacation.
